Output 8603268aa067657a2b53195b9f191c4011390fb6d662c66d0b626d6827a73f92:1

value
75420112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1fd1c74871024ce6153e8977cc45741cb714b72 OP_EQUAL
address
MNfgEnYjdBkBmxVBArACbjpyB84DGAJ5q5
transaction
8603268aa067657a2b53195b9f191c4011390fb6d662c66d0b626d6827a73f92
spent
true